Primary processing refers to the extraction process that converts raw materials into ingredients. Secondary processing is then needed to turn processed ingredients into edible food products. Furthermore, tertiary processing is the stage of manipulating already processed food products to develop a ready-to-eat item. Food sourcing is among the most vital elements of the food and beverage industries. It incorporates all agricultural and farming practices that are associated with the production of raw materials. Ingredients can be obtained from a range of providers. Regional sourcing refers to purchases from close-by farms and manufacturers. It is the most direct way of buying produce and is favoured for being environmentally friendly. Alternatively, worldwide sourcing or importing resources is a very popular strategy. It permits nations to optimise climate and growth conditions to grow indigenous crops and circulate them to various parts of the world. Additionally, organically produced and sustainable sourcing is a present area of focus for lots of suppliers. Using environmentally conscious practices and fair-trade guidelines ensures the ethical procurement of food sources in the present day.
